Uncategorized2 years ago
G7 condemns Ukraine referendums as “legitimate”.
Voting in Russian-occupied territories continued today, as did the condemnation of referendums. (Subscribe to: President Putin is expected to formally declare these areas part of Russia...
Recent Comments